Patent number: 10894207Abstract: An example of peripheral device adds a predetermined function to a mobile device having an infrared communication function. The peripheral device includes an additional function unit, an infrared communication unit, and a support unit. The additional function unit has the predetermined function. The infrared communication unit is capable of performing infrared communication with the mobile device. The support unit detachably supports the mobile device so that a light emitting/receiving unit for infrared light of the mobile device is positioned so as to be capable of transmitting or receiving infrared light to or from the infrared communication unit.Type: GrantFiled: December 5, 2018Date of Patent: January 19, 2021Assignee: NINTENDO CO., LTD.Inventors: Ryuji Umezu, Yuki Taniguchi, Munetaka Nishikawa

Patent number: 9282319Abstract: A hand-held image display apparatus includes a touch panel, a stereoscopic display apparatus, a first imaging section, and a second imaging section. The hand-held image display apparatus detects a marker from a real world image shot by at least one of the first imaging section and the second imaging section, and determines the relative positions of a virtual object and a pair of virtual cameras with respect to each other in a virtual space, based on the result of the detection. Then, the hand-held image display apparatus superimposes virtual space images drawn based on the first virtual camera and the second virtual camera, onto the real world images shot by the first imaging section and the second imaging section, and displays images that are stereoscopically visible by naked eyes, on the stereoscopic display apparatus.Type: GrantFiled: January 22, 2013Date of Patent: March 8, 2016Assignee: NINTENDO CO., LTD.Inventors: Hideki Konno, Ryuji Umezu, Kenichi Sugino, Kouichi Kawamoto, Kenta Kubo

Patent number: 8894486Abstract: A game apparatus includes a stereoscopic image display device configured to display a stereoscopic image, which is stereoscopically visible by the naked eye, and a planar image display device configured to display a planar image. A touch panel is provided on a screen of the planar image display device. An image of a silhouette of an object in a virtual space is displayed on the planar image display device. The game apparatus causes the object in the virtual space to move according to a touch operation performed on the image of the silhouette displayed on the screen of the planar image display device, and stereoscopically displays the object on the stereoscopic image display device.Type: GrantFiled: January 13, 2011Date of Patent: November 25, 2014Assignee: Nintendo Co., Ltd.Inventors: Hideki Konno, Ryuji Umezu, Kenichi Sugino

Patent number: 8584260Abstract: A storage medium includes an ID registration area for storing therein a main body ID which is an ID unique to an information processing apparatus. The information processing apparatus has the main body ID stored therein. The information processing apparatus includes copying means for, when the storage medium is attached thereto, copying a program stored in the storage medium thereinto in the case where the main body ID has not yet been registered. When the copy is made, the main body ID is stored into the ID registration area of the storage medium. The information processing apparatus also includes execution program selecting means for selecting, from the copied program and from the program stored in the storage medium, a program to be executed.Type: GrantFiled: June 10, 2008Date of Patent: November 12, 2013Assignee: Nintendo Co., Ltd.Inventor: Ryuji Umezu

Publication number: 20120133641Abstract: An upper LCD capable of displaying an image which is stereoscopically visible with naked eyes is provided on an upper housing of a hand-held electronic device. A 3D adjustment switch for adjusting a parallax of a stereoscopic image is provided on the upper housing. When a slider of the 3D adjustment switch is within a predetermined range between an uppermost position and a position slightly above a lowermost position, the stereoscopic effect of the stereoscopic image is adjusted based on the position of the slider. When the slider of the 3D adjustment switch is at the lowermost position, a planar image corresponding to the stereoscopic image is displayed on the upper LCD.Type: ApplicationFiled: May 27, 2011Publication date: May 31, 2012Applicant: NINTENDO CO., LTD.Inventors: Ryuji Umezu, Hideki Konno, Kenichi Sugino
